Environment Considerations: How Bay Area Conditions Affect Flooring Choices
The Bay Area experiences a mix of seaside moisture and inland dry skin, relying on where you live. These conditions can impact exactly how various flooring products behave gradually.
Hardwood floorings, constructed from natural product, can expand or get with temperature and moisture modifications. Proper adjustment prior to installation and maintaining indoor moisture levels can assist decrease this activity. Still, in homes without climate control, it's something to be familiar with.
Plastic, on the other hand, is much much less conscious moisture and temperature level variations. It preserves its form and framework also in damp or variable atmospheres, making it a solid challenger for cellars, shower rooms, or cooking areas.
Durability and Investment: What You Get Over Time
If you're believing lasting, hardwood flooring commonly pays off. Though it calls for a larger initial financial investment, it dramatically improves home worth and stands the test of time. With appropriate upkeep, consisting of the occasional wood floor refinishing service, wood can offer a home for generations. It ages beautifully and contributes to a home's general appeal and credibility.
Vinyl, while even more inexpensive upfront, does not have the very same lengthy lifespan. Many vinyl floors last around 10 to 20 years, relying on the quality and wear, which indicates they may require to be replaced regularly. Still, for property owners seeking an adaptable, cost-efficient choice or who enjoy upgrading their interiors more frequently, vinyl makes best feeling.

Installation: What to Expect from the Process
Setting up wood floor covering is usually extra labor-intensive and lengthy. It commonly calls for subfloor preparation, exact cutting, and ending up. That's why lots of house owners choose knowledgeable hardwood floor installation companies to guarantee a smooth this page and perfect result.
Plastic floor covering, specifically the high-end vinyl slab variety, offers quicker and easier installation. Some types can be drifted over existing floorings, saving time and labor. This rate and simplicity make it an excellent option for immediate jobs or minimal restoration home windows.
